What is solar rail splice?

Rail splice play roles in joining two mounting rails together for large scale solar panel mounts. 1. Work as extension joints for two racking rails; 2. Secured supports for mounting rails; 3. Help saving transport freight and installing cost; Any shape of customized splices are available designed your solar rail section .

Can PV modules be mounted on rooftops / ground?

Large quantities of PV modules can be mounted on rooftops / ground by multiple supports of rail splice and rails. the longest length of aluminum rails which produced from factory could not be longer than 7 meters. In the mean time, it will cause difficult transportation and installation for too long in piece.
